Common Problems: MG MGF
Known issues reported by owners and MOT testers.
- Hydragas Suspension Leaks/Depressurisation(Moderate)
The unique interconnected fluid/gas suspension system can leak or lose pressure over time, leading to a harsh ride and low ground clearance.
- Head Gasket Failure(Serious)
Standard K-Series issue, exacerbated by the mid-engine layout and long coolant pipes to the front radiator.
